Asmita College of Architecture Bachelor of Architecture [B.Arch] Admission 2024

Eligibility:

  • Passed Higher Secondary School Certificate (10+2) or its equivalent examination with English and a minimum of 50% aggregate marks in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ics.
  • Passed NATA (National Aptitude Test in Architecture) with a valid score.

Asmita College of Architecture Bachelor of Architecture [B.Arch] Selection Criteria

  1. Educational Qualifications:

    • Candidates are typically required to have completed higher secondary education (10+2) or an equivalent qualification from a recognized board with a focus on mathematics as a subject.
  2. Entrance Examination (if applicable):

    • Many architecture colleges, including Asmita College, may conduct an entrance examination designed to assess a candidate's aptitude for architecture. Performance in this exam can be a crucial factor in the selection process.
  3. NATA (National Aptitude Test in Architecture) Scores:

    • NATA scores are often considered for B.Arch admissions. NATA is a national-level examination that evaluates the drawing and observation skills, sense of proportion, aesthetic sensitivity, and critical thinking ability of candidates.
  4. Portfolio Assessment:

    • A portfolio showcasing the candidate's previous work, such as drawings, sketches, and design projects, may be evaluated. This helps assess the applicant's creativity, design sensibility, and potential for architectural studies.
  5. Interview or Counseling:

    • Some colleges conduct interviews or counseling sessions to understand the candidate's motivation, passion for architecture, and future goals. This interaction can also provide an opportunity for candidates to discuss their portfolio.
  6. Mathematics Proficiency:

    • Since mathematics is a fundamental aspect of architecture, proficiency in mathematics at the higher secondary level may be considered in the selection process.
  7. Relevant Subject Proficiency:

    • Proficiency in subjects such as physics and chemistry may also be considered, as these subjects are relevant to architectural studies.
  8. Written Test or Aptitude Test:

    • Some colleges may include a written test or an aptitude test to assess the candidate's logical reasoning, general awareness, and communication skills.
  9. Merit-Based Selection:

    • Merit-based selection considers the overall academic performance of candidates in the qualifying examination.
  10. Reservation and Quotas:

    • Colleges often follow government regulations regarding reservations and quotas for categories such as SC/ST/OBC/PWD. Candidates falling under these categories may have specific criteria to meet.
  11. Document Verification:

    • Shortlisted candidates are usually required to submit necessary documents for verification. This includes mark sheets, certificates, NATA scores, and other relevant documents.
